Methods for Clearing Away Contaminants and Debris

Reliable approaches for clearing away debris and contaminants from aquatic bodies play a vital role in preserving water quality and ecosystem health. Among the most common methods are mechanical removal and chemical treatments. Mechanical removal involves employing specialized equipment, such as skimmers and dredgers, to physically pull out debris like leaves, algae, and sediment from the water. This approach lessens disruption to the aquatic environment while effectively decreasing pollutant levels.

Chemical-based treatments, including algaecides and herbicides, can target specific contaminants but must be used judiciously to minimize harming non-target species. Biological methods, including introducing beneficial microorganisms, present an eco-friendly alternative for decomposing organic waste and pollutants.

Consistent monitoring of water quality can guide the implementation of these methods, ensuring ideal results. By utilizing a combination of these approaches, pond and lake managers can greatly boost the health and sustainability of aquatic ecosystems.

Effective Strategies for Controlling Invasive Species

Invasive species pose significant challenges to the health of ponds and lakes, often outcompeting native flora and fauna for resources. To manage these invaders effectively, a combination of strategies is essential. Initially, early detection and rapid response are critical; monitoring programs can identify invasive species before they establish significant populations. In addition, manual removal methods, such as hand-pulling or mechanical harvesting, can be effective for smaller infestations. Moreover, chemical treatments may be applied judiciously, ensuring that they do not adversely affect native species or water quality. Furthermore, public education and community involvement can raise awareness about preventing the introduction of invasive species. Moreover, restoring native plant communities helps to create a resilient ecosystem capable of outcompeting invasive species. By implementing these strategies, pond and lake managers can effectively reduce the impact of invasive species while promoting the overall health of aquatic environments.

Enhancing Water Quality for Wildlife

While the health of aquatic ecosystems is vital for supporting wide-ranging wildlife, enhancing water quality remains a fundamental challenge for pond and lake managers. High nutrient levels, often resulting from runoff, can result in harmful algal blooms that deplete oxygen and endanger aquatic life. Proven management practices emphasize reducing these nutrient inputs through buffer zones and sediment control.

Additionally, sustaining optimal pH levels and temperature is crucial for the longevity of delicate species. Administrators often watch these parameters attentively to ensure a balanced ecosystem. The establishment of native plant species can improve water filtration and offer habitats for explore this fish and invertebrates, consequently supporting biodiversity.

Consistent reviews and adaptations to management strategies are essential, as conditions can transform fast. In the end, the commitment to improving water quality not only aids wildlife but also enhances the recreational value of aquatic environments for the local community.

Green Cleaning Methods

Sustainable management of ponds and lakes progressively focuses on natural cleaning methods, which exploit the potential of ecosystems to reestablish water quality without harmful chemicals. These techniques include the introduction of beneficial bacteria and enzymes that degrade organic matter, consequently promoting a balanced ecosystem. Aquatic plants play an essential role by absorbing excess nutrients, which supports controlling alg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can copyright a healthy aquatic environment. Regularly aerating the water improves oxygen levels, supporting the breakdown of pollutants. By combining these natural techniques, water bodies can attain improved clarity and health while conserving the delicate balance of their ecosystems, ultimately producing sustainable and effective management practices.
